SAP S/4HANA EWM Permanent Consultant:

***THIS IS AN ONSITE POSITION IN PITTSBURGH, PA. IN-OFFICE WORK REQUIREMENTS A MINIMUM OF 3 DAYS PER WEEK.

We are seeking a highly experienced SAP S/4HANA EWM Consultant with strong expertise in warehouse management processes and SAP EWM functionality to deliver optimal solutions for business requirements. The ideal candidate will have demonstrated experience in deploying SAP S4 warehousing solution along with foundational knowledge of SAP S/4 TM (Transportation Management) functionality.

The role involves collaborating with global and regional organizations, as well as Shared Services and Production Sites, to drive solution consulting and design new solutions aligned with best practices. The objective is to achieve the highest level of efficiency and sustainability in the global transportation and logistics solutions.


Major Tasks and Responsibilities:

Design and implement SAP S/4HANA EWM solutions aligned with business requirements

Configure warehouse structures, storage bins, Handling Unit (HU) and process flows within the EWM system

Develop and customize EWM functionalities including inbound/outbound processing, internal warehouse movements, and inventory management

Implement and maintain EWM-TM integration scenarios to ensure seamless logistics operations

Design and optimize warehouse execution processes that align with transportation requirements

Support RF-enabled warehouse operations and their connection to transportation processes

Collaborate on integration points between TM and EWM modules

Create technical specifications for any required enhancements or interfaces

Perform system testing and support user acceptance testing

Provide post-implementation support and troubleshooting

Create documentation for system configurations and user procedures

Train end users on EWM functionality and processes

Domestic travel up to 25% within first year
